有个应用在用80端口,之后装了个宝塔,修改了80为什么,还出现,警告消息:80端口占用,求大佬怎么搞
server
{
listen81;
server_namephpmyadmin;
indexindex.htmlindex.htmindex.php;
root /www/server/phpmyadmin;
#error_page 404 /404.html;
includeenable-php.conf;
location~.*.(gif|jpg|jpeg|png|bmp|swf)$
启动后出现
警告消息:
nginx:[emerg]bind()to0.0.0.0:80failed(98:Addressalreadyinuse)
nginx:[emerg]bind()to0.0.0.0:80failed(98:Addressalreadyinuse)
解决了,这三个文件全改了就行了
/www/server/panel/vhost/nginx/0.default.conf
/www/server/panel/vhost/nginx/phpfpm_status.conf
/www/server/panel/vhost/nginx/phpinfo.conf
看到这个文章解决的:https://cangshui.net/3220.html
-----------------------------------------------------
网友回复:
80端口被占用,nginx无法启动;修改端口需要修改nginx.conf这里的才能启动;要么就修改用80端口的应用
网友回复:
引用:Ticifer发表于2020-9-3018:07
80端口被占用,nginx无法启动;修改端口需要修改nginx.conf这里的才能启动;要么就修改用80端口的应用...
网友回复:
netstat-lntp
看看80端口是哪个在用
网友回复:
引用:在也不买小鸡了发表于2020-9-3018:12
修改了/www/server/nginx/conf目录下的nginx.conf没用
网友回复:
引用:大屁股发表于2020-9-3018:19
换apahe
网友回复:
引用:XieZeBin发表于2020-9-3018:24
端口被占换什么都是扯淡,除非就是Apache占用的80
网友回复:
netstat-nlp|grep80
看占用,
然后kill-9XXXX
关闭它
网友回复:
引用:大屁股发表于2020-9-3018:19
换apahe
网友回复:
引用:拼多多小鸡用户发表于2020-9-3018:30
netstat-nlp|grep80
看占用,
网友回复:
引用:在也不买小鸡了发表于2020-9-3018:32
换了没用,无法开启apahe
网友回复:
引用:Ticifer发表于2020-9-3018:23
netstat-nlp|grep80 自己看看是什么占用先
网友回复:
引用:在也不买小鸡了发表于2020-9-3018:33
能共存嘛
网友回复:
引用:在也不买小鸡了发表于2020-9-3018:35
停掉那个就能用,有办法一起用80端口嘛
网友回复:
引用:hjvn2211445发表于2020-9-3019:02
是不是你修改完没重启ng
网友回复:
你看一下nginx.conf文件里面有没有引用别的文件。导致还有别的虚拟站点在使用80端口。
如果是宝塔的话。你打开这个文件最下面肯定有一句:include/www/server/panel/vhost/nginx/*.conf;
然后你按这个路径找过去看看还有那个程序在占用80咯。
网友回复:
引用:guoguomiao发表于2020-9-3019:45
你看一下nginx.conf文件里面有没有引用别的文件。导致还有别的虚拟站点在使用80端口。
如果是宝塔的话。你...